net: dsa: mt7530: remove interface checks

As phylink checks the interface mode against the supported_interfaces
bitmap, we no longer need to validate the interface mode, nor handle
PHY_INTERFACE_MODE_NA in the validation function. Remove these to
simplify the implementation.
